Apple (AAPL) has yet to submit data sought by the Competition Commission of India, India’s antitrust body, after an investigation found the company abused its dominant position in the apps market, Aditya Kalra of Reuters reports. This has prompted the watchdog to fast-track a decision on penalties to a hearing next month.
